Willow Arden finds herself lost after her best friend marries the Prince of Cornetta and ends up with a promise of a job offer to work for the royal family planning the coronation for the future King, Prince Emory Vicenza. When Willow finds herself alone with the prince she thinks maybe he is different from the reputation he has gotten but with one wrong word she turns him down to spend the night together. A year later Emory returns to Cornetta ready to take his place as the King but will a budding romance between Willow and Emory get in the way?
I loved this book from the characters to the setting. Willow seemed to be a very relatable character while Emory was everything you would expect from a royal but not in a bad way.
